The Center for Folklore Archives
Research (CFAR), a joint enterprise of the Indiana University Department of
Folklore and Ethnomusicology and the Indiana University Archives, serves several
important functions within our Folklore Archives. As a growing center for
research and outreach activities, CFAR strives to go beyond preserving archival
documents and to actively build on current holdings by creating dynamic
presentations and exhibits deriving from the materials housed in the Folklore
Archives.
Our aim is to make CFAR an indispensable resource on
traditional and popular forms of thought and expression. With a core focus on
student life at IU, and a wider emphasis on expressive traditions in the state
of Indiana and more broadly, in the Midwest, CFAR offers a unique combination of
resources associated with the art of everyday life as revealed in the expressive
forms of folklore and ethnomusicology. Featured components of the Folklore
Archives include the Ethnography Collection, with its extensive inventory of
student fieldwork papers documenting campus life since the late 1940s; the
Professional Papers Collection, consisting of the professional papers of
prominent folklorists who either studied or taught at IU; the Departmental
Papers Collection, featuring documents tied to the Folklore Institute and the
Department of Folklore and Ethnomusicology at IU; and Special Collections,
featuring a variety of significant holdings of expressive and traditional
materials contributed to the Folklore Archives.
Through activities sponsored by CFAR, we seek to breathe life
into these archival materials and celebrate the pivotal role played by faculty,
students, and staff at Indiana University in the origin and development of both
folkloristics and ethnomusicology in the United States.
